GPU-Z is a lightweight utility designed to give you all information about your video card and GPU. It doesn't even require to be installed, all you have to do is run it. It supports NVIDIA and ATI cards, it will provide you with information about your display adapter, GPU and display. It displays overclock (if applicable), default clocks and 3D clocks

Fixed GPU-Z window getting cut off on non-standard DPI settings
Fixed overclock calculation error on NVIDIA non-Kepler GPUs
Fixed GPU-Z not starting or crashing the machine on systems with broken HPET implementation
Fixed SLI not getting detected under Windows XP
Fixed garbled board name on some older Radeon cards
Fixed several memory leaks
L6788A voltage controller on HD 7750 and HD 7770 will now display correct default voltage
Added support for NVIDIA Tesla M2070
